MoneyHero Limited (MNY) Q3 2025 Earnings Call Transcript

Key Financial Performance

Revenue $21.1 million in Q3 2025, up 17% quarter-on-quarter and 1% year-on-year. The modest year-over-year growth reflects a deliberate reshaping of the volume mix, focusing on higher-margin products like insurance and wealth.

Adjusted EBITDA Loss of $1.8 million in Q3 2025, improved by 68% year-over-year. Adjusted EBITDA margin improved from -26.5% to -8.4% year-over-year, driven by cost reductions and a shift to higher-margin revenue.

Net Loss Narrowed from $19.6 million in the first 9 months of 2024 to $5.7 million in the same period of 2025, reflecting improved operational efficiency and cost management.

Insurance Revenue $2.3 million in Q3 2025, up 13% year-over-year, driven by a strategic focus on high-margin verticals.

Wealth Revenue $2.6 million in Q3 2025, up 5% year-over-year, reflecting a deliberate shift towards high-margin products.

Operating Costs $23.9 million in Q3 2025, down 13% year-over-year. Technology costs decreased from $2 million to $0.9 million, and employee benefit expenses fell from $5.7 million to $4.2 million, driven by AI-driven automation and restructuring efforts.

Singapore Revenue $10.2 million in Q3 2025, up from $7.9 million a year ago, due to improved approval quality and broader product depth.

Hong Kong Revenue $7.5 million in Q3 2025, slightly lower year-over-year due to a reduction in low-margin credit card campaigns, but showing sequential stabilization.

Taiwan and Philippines Revenue $1 million and $2.4 million respectively in Q3 2025, reflecting gradual recovery after operational issues and partner strategy resets.

Operating Highlights

Project Odyssey: A strategic AI initiative integrating performance marketing, content automation, credit scoring intelligence, membership enrichment, conversational journeys, and service automation. It is expected to improve CAC efficiency, funnel conversion, and reward optimizations, while automating over 60% of service interactions. This initiative positions MoneyHero as an AI-native financial decisioning platform.

Credit Hero Club: A newly launched initiative in Hong Kong focusing on personal loans, contributing to revenue growth in Q4.

Geographic Performance: Singapore showed strong performance with revenue rising to $10.2 million from $7.9 million a year ago, driven by improved approval quality and broader product depth. Hong Kong revenue was $7.5 million, slightly lower year-on-year due to reduced low-margin credit card campaigns but showed sequential stabilization. Taiwan and the Philippines are recovering gradually after Citibank's exit.

Revenue Growth: Q3 revenue was $21.1 million, up 17% quarter-on-quarter and 1% year-on-year, driven by healthier unit economics and a deliberate shift to higher-margin products.

Cost Reduction: Operating costs fell 13% year-on-year to $23.9 million, with significant reductions in technology costs (from $2 million to $0.9 million) and employee benefit expenses (from $5.7 million to $4.2 million).

AI-Driven Efficiency: 70%-80% of service inquiries are now automated, enabling flat headcount despite growing application volumes.

Revenue Mix Shift: Insurance and wealth now account for 23% of revenue, up from 21% a year ago, with insurance revenue up 13% year-on-year and wealth revenue up 5% year-on-year. These high-margin verticals are central to the company's strategy.

Profitability Focus: Q4 is expected to be the first profitable quarter on an adjusted EBITDA basis since listing, driven by high-margin verticals, cost discipline, and AI-enabled efficiencies.

Risk or Challenges

Market Conditions: The company faces challenges in recovering revenue in Taiwan and the Philippines due to the exit of Citibank's operations, which has impacted partner acquisition strategies. These markets are not yet back to full run rate.

Competitive Pressures: The company is operating in a fragmented market and needs to establish leadership while competing with other fintech companies capable of combining profitable growth, structural expansion, and capital-light free cash flow.

Regulatory Hurdles: The company emphasizes a regulatory-first approach in designing AI journeys to ensure suitability, transparency, and consumer protection, which could pose challenges in aligning with regulatory requirements.

Economic Uncertainties: Revenue in Hong Kong has been slightly lower year-on-year due to a proactive reduction of low-margin credit card campaigns, reflecting economic adjustments and strategic shifts.

Strategic Execution Risks: The company is undergoing a strategic reset and pivoting towards higher-margin products like insurance and wealth. This deliberate mix shift requires disciplined capital allocation and execution to ensure sustainable profitability.

Guidance & Outlook

Annual Revenue Growth: The company expects to deliver healthy annual revenue growth over the next few years, driven by a revenue mix shift towards higher-margin products and AI-enabled operating leverage through Project Odyssey.

Margin Expansion: Continued margin expansion is anticipated, supported by structurally lower operating costs and the growth of high-margin verticals such as insurance and wealth.

Positive Free Cash Flow: Sustained positive free cash flow is expected, with incremental revenue increasingly flowing through to the bottom line.

Project Odyssey Impact: Project Odyssey is projected to drive meaningful improvements in unit economics, including lower customer acquisition costs (CAC), higher approval quality, and better funnel conversion. It is expected to deliver substantial annual EBITDA improvements over the next few years.

Q4 Adjusted EBITDA: The company expects Q4 adjusted EBITDA to be positive, marking the first profitable quarter on an adjusted EBITDA basis since listing.

2026 Financial Goals: For 2026, the company targets solid top-line growth, meaningful profitability improvement, and a further revenue mix shift towards high-margin verticals like insurance and wealth.

Capital Allocation: The company plans to invest in Project Odyssey, the Credit Hero Club, and real-time car insurance journeys, while exploring consolidation opportunities and evaluating share repurchases once free cash flow is established.

Key Q&A

Q:What is the plan for the crypto segment since you have announced the partnership with OSL, HashKey, and the survey with Coinbase? Any revenue target or goal from this segment?
A:The approach to crypto is deliberate, regulated, and compliance-first. The partnership with OSL provides an institutional-grade partner for execution. They launched the 'Pulse of Crypto Singapore' survey to provide market insights and align with regulatory expectations. The company aims to educate, compare, and route users to regulated platforms without taking balance sheet risks. Over time, digital assets will be integrated into broader wealth journeys. No standalone crypto revenue target is set, but it is expected to become a meaningful contributor within the wealth segment over the next 2-3 years.
Q:Can you elaborate about the AI displacement risk because you are a comparison platform?
A:AI is seen as an amplifier of value rather than a risk. The company has vertical integration in insurance, deeper integrations in credit, and is moving towards data-driven insights. Project Odyssey enhances their AI capabilities. They position themselves as an AI-enhanced layer between users and providers, aggregating, normalizing, and curating data rather than being a static list.
Q:Can you share with us if there is any further partnership potential?
A:The company is in close dialogue with major backers like Pacific Century Group and explores partnerships within the ecosystem, particularly in Hong Kong. They aim for collaborations that align with their distribution and product strategy, as exemplified by their relationship with Bolttech.
Q:Revenue was flat year-on-year in the third quarter, but adjusted EBITDA improved significantly. Is that within your expectation? What are the drivers of this improvement? Why are you confident in Q4 and beyond?
A:Revenue was flat at $21.1 million, but adjusted EBITDA improved by 68% due to a high-quality revenue mix and lower operating costs. Insurance grew 13% and wealth grew 5%, contributing to 23% of group revenue. Operating costs fell 13%, driven by optimized marketing, technology consolidation, and AI-driven automation. Confidence in Q4 and beyond is based on structural revenue mix improvements, sequential growth momentum, and a fundamentally different cost base. Q4 is expected to be the first quarter of positive adjusted EBITDA since listing, with profitability scaling in 2026.
Q:With the talk about positive cash flow coming, is there any plan to use that on M&A or focus on the existing business and driving profitability?
A:The capital allocation philosophy prioritizes organic investment in the core engine, scaling Project Odyssey, and deepening AI advantages. M&A will be pursued in a disciplined way, focusing on acquisitions that offer clear revenue or cost synergies, stronger capabilities, strategic scale, and fit the AI-enabled operating model.
Q:Can you talk about the reception of the Credit Hero Club and provide an update on the loan segment for Q4 and 2026?
A:The Credit Hero Club, launched in Hong Kong in partnership with TransUnion, provides free credit profiles and scores, enabling personalized credit offers. It amplifies seasonality like tax loans and enhances off-season contextual and real-time credit needs. The personal loan segment in Hong Kong is important, with strong partnerships and exclusive offers. The Credit Hero Club is expected to scale and strengthen the loan strategy.
Q:Can you provide an outlook on the different segments for 2026?
A:Credit cards will remain a core vertical with medium to high-intent users and moderate seasonality but low to medium margins. Personal loans are cyclical but improving in margins, supported by initiatives like the Credit Hero Club. Insurance offers higher margins and lower seasonality, serving as a core EBITDA anchor. Wealth, including brokerage accounts and digital assets, has moderate to high margins with long-term upside. The strategy focuses on shifting towards higher-margin verticals, improving economics in cyclical categories, and achieving strong operating leverage. EBITDA is expected to improve significantly in 2026 and beyond.
